Subject: [PATCH 6/8] i.MX27 pcm038: Add USB support
Date: Thu, 4 Feb 2010 16:03:43 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1265295825-8705-7-git-send-email-s.hauer@pengutronix.de>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1265295825-8705-6-git-send-email-s.hauer@pengutronix.de>
Signed-off-by: Sascha Hauer <s.hauer@pengutronix.de>
---
arch/arm/mach-mx2/Kconfig | 1 +
arch/arm/mach-mx2/mach-pcm038.c | 22 ++++++++++++++++++++++
2 files changed, 23 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-mx2/Kconfig b/arch/arm/mach-mx2/Kconfig
index ca1278d..742fd4e 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-mx2/Kconfig
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-mx2/Kconfig
@@ -37,6 +37,7 @@ config MACH_MX27ADS
config MACH_PCM038
bool "Phytec phyCORE-i.MX27 CPU module (pcm038)"
depends on MACH_MX27
+ select MXC_ULPI if USB_ULPI
help
Include support for phyCORE-i.MX27 (aka pcm038) platform. This
includes specific configurations for the module and its peripherals.
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-mx2/mach-pcm038.c b/arch/arm/mach-mx2/mach-pcm038.c
index e055d9d..5a0169c 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-mx2/mach-pcm038.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-mx2/mach-pcm038.c
@@ -40,6 +40,8 @@
#include <mach/imx-uart.h>
#include <mach/mxc_nand.h>
#include <mach/spi.h>
+#include <mach/mxc_ehci.h>
+#include <mach/ulpi.h>
#include "devices.h"
@@ -96,6 +98,19 @@ static int pcm038_pins[] = {
PC17_PF_SSI4_RXD,
PC18_PF_SSI4_TXD,
PC19_PF_SSI4_CLK,
+ /* USB host */
+ PA0_PF_USBH2_CLK,
+ PA1_PF_USBH2_DIR,
+ PA2_PF_USBH2_DATA7,
+ PA3_PF_USBH2_NXT,
+ PA4_PF_USBH2_STP,
+ PD19_AF_USBH2_DATA4,
+ PD20_AF_USBH2_DATA3,
+ PD21_AF_USBH2_DATA6,
+ PD22_AF_USBH2_DATA0,
+ PD23_AF_USBH2_DATA2,
+ PD24_AF_USBH2_DATA1,
+ PD26_AF_USBH2_DATA5,
};
/*
@@ -277,6 +292,11 @@ static struct spi_board_info pcm038_spi_board_info[] __initdata = {
}
};
+static struct mxc_usbh_platform_data usbh2_pdata = {
+ .portsc = MXC_EHCI_MODE_ULPI,
+ .flags = MXC_EHCI_POWER_PINS_ENABLED | MXC_EHCI_INTERFACE_DIFF_UNI,
+};
+
static void __init pcm038_init(void)
{
mxc_gpio_setup_multiple_pins(pcm038_pins, ARRAY_SIZE(pcm038_pins),
@@ -309,6 +329,8 @@ static void __init pcm038_init(void)
spi_register_board_info(pcm038_spi_board_info,
ARRAY_SIZE(pcm038_spi_board_info));
+ mxc_register_device(&mxc_usbh2, &usbh2_pdata);
+
platform_add_devices(platform_devices, ARRAY_SIZE(platform_devices));
#ifdef CONFIG_MACH_PCM970_BASEBOARD
